WebDec 4, 2024 · 2. Type the Command. In this example, we will set the gamerule to keep inventory after dying with the following command: /gamerule keepInventory true. Type the command in the chat window. As you are typing, you will see the command appear in the lower left corner of the game window. Press the Enter key to run the command. Game Rule data is stored as part of the underlying world data, rather than loading from the server.properties file. Therefore, the only way to change Game Rules is through running the /gamerule command while in-game. Fortunately, they do persist with the world, so you only need to run them once. dramとは わかりやすく
